Blackberry Delight

ingredients
Blackberry Layer
6 cups fresh blackberries
1 1/2 cup sugar
2 teaspoons cornstarch
Cream Cheese Layer
1 package (8 ounce size) cream cheese
1/2 cup sugar
1/4 teaspoon vanilla extract
Dough
2 cups all-purpose flour
3 teaspoons baking powder
1 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
8 tablespoons solid butter flavored shortening
1/2 cup sugar
3/4 cup milk
directions
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
For Blackberry Layer: Place blackberries into stove top pot with lid. Cook on medium low for 15 minutes until juice renders.
Mix sugar and cornstarch together, add to blueberries. Cook until mixture thickens, 5 to 10 minutes. Set aside.
For Cream Cheese Layer: Mix cream cheese with sugar, vanilla in mixer; set aside.
For Dough: Mix flour, baking powder, salt and cinnamon; mix well. Add shortening one tablespoon at a time; incorporate with fork. Mix sugar and milk into mixture.
Spray oval (12-1/2 x 7-1/2 x 3-1/2 inch) baking dish with nonstick cooking spray. Place half of dough mixture into bottom of dish. Pour half of blueberry mixture on top.
Pour cream cheese mixture onto blueberries. Pour remaining blackberries onto cream cheese mixture, followed by the remaining dough mixture.
Place in oven. Bake for 35-40 minutes or until bubbly in the middle.
Serve warm with or without ice cream in dessert dishes.
